Biography

Fataneh Taghaboni-Dutta is a clinical professor of business administration, a position she has held since 2009. Her teaching interests lie in the area of operations and process management, including product development and design, operation and technology strategy, and project management. She focuses her research on integration of technology with management and on process improvement. Her current research priority is on the development and deployment of Radio Frequency Identification (RFID) technology in manufacturing and global supply chain. Taghaboni-Dutta has earned three degrees in industrial engineering from Purdue University: a BS in 1983, an MS in 1986, and a PhD in 1989.

Current Courses

  • Project Management (BADM 377) In-depth treatment of management concepts, tools, and techniques that apply to the organization, planning, and control of projects; particular emphasis on analyzing needs, defining work, scheduling tasks, allocating resources; assessing costs, managing risks; tracking and evaluating performance; and building and leading teams.

  • Stat for Mgt Decision Making (BADM 572) The application of classical and modern statistics for business decision making. The level of the course assumes some prior knowledge of basic statistics as well as facility with elementary calculus.

  • Project Management (BADM 589) Managing projects is a vital part of everyone's job in today's companies. This course aims to help you master the project management process. Central to this course is developing your understanding and ability to manage the technical dimensions of needs analysis, work breakdown, scheduling, resource allocation, risk management, and performance tracking and evaluation such that you can accomplish them while staying within the project's allocated time frame and cost. This course is also mindful of the sociocultural dimensions of the project management process, which include attributes of sound leadership, formation and management of impactful teams, and managing customer expectations.
